Output 12dbf031f8627381c2a256481c6c13c66840c28a1d2dcff781242688a46c6fab:1

value
20740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d750a98bd14c6c74f6eaeaa22d4372ae57b3831 OP_EQUALVERIFY OP_CHECKSIG
address
16bxRt43Zct2PTxxkQxV2NbmioQJPXF7wm
transaction
12dbf031f8627381c2a256481c6c13c66840c28a1d2dcff781242688a46c6fab
confirmations
530419
spent
true